Bed Rail Caps

I'm in need of a new bed Rail cap on my passenger side (want to do both). Bed needs fixing back there on the upper corner too.



If you'd like I can get another picture without the rack in the way since it's off now.

I'm having trouble finding calls for a 2000 model. Everything I'm finding is listed for 2002 and up.

What are the differences?

Can I put the '02+ caps on my '00?

IF not, anyone know where I can find a pair of new caps at a reasonable price?

Originally Posted by FiveOJester
Here’s pics of my stock 06 rails. I was always under the impression the beds are all the same from 99-16 on the super duty.

Mostly the same. Body lines and wheel arches changed slightly on 2008+ trucks, but they'll still fit the earlier chassis. 2008+ beds might also have a larger fuel door. Taillight wiring may be slightly different from year to year.

I can actually find OEM replacements through Ford dealers, but it's ~$150+ per side. So looking at $300+ to replace both through Ford and then add repair costs for the crunch.

I can find aftermarket replacement, which I have no problem using, listed for the 2002-2016 trucks for less than $100 set. That's a little easier to stomach. I think I've also seen the later model OEM parts available cheaper from third parties online.

What I can't figure out is what changed from 2001 to 2002 that they won't fit the earlier trucks. The bed looks the same, but is the mounting different? Was hoping someone here had been around enough of these to be aware of the difference, if there is one at all.​​​​​
